    ILB has been a key to the Steelers defense ever since they switched to the 3-4, even when Lambert was still playing. The edges get all the glory, but guys like Little, Foote, Farrior, Timmons, Shazier, etc., have been staples in the defense. That is why they traded up for Bush. Many of the draftniks do not know what they are talking about, but I remember the draft "experts" did not like Bush, and the discussion on this board, posters on here warned us to stay away from Bush.

    The Steelers need to get back to finding ILBers that are difference makers. Look at the Ravens, they draft Queen in round 1 and trade for Smith a former top ten pick, then draft Simpson, who may replace Queen, because they may not be able to pay both Queen and Smith.

    My hope is that Khan and Weidl continue to improve the roster through the draft, and we have less of the Bush and Claypool type picks that set the organization back.

    he has 4 picks the last 3 years and 13 passes defended in 18 games.

    here in 7 games he has 2 passes defended. 1 interception. 1 sack. 31 tackles.

    kwon has 9 games. 1 pass defended. 1 interception. 41 tackles. 1 sack.

    holcomb has 8 games. 2 passes defended. 0 interceptions. 54 tackles. 0 sacks.

    roberts has 15 games. 2 passes defended. 0 interceptions. 100 tackles. 2.5 sacks.

    those stats tend to disagree with you. he's pretty much right on par with our other LB'ers. just so ya know. :cool:
